Chapter 122: Going to the meeting alone
Soft facial features, pink cheeks in snow white, and regular ups and downs of the chest, like a sleeping beauty in a fairy tale waiting for the true son to kiss her awake. The only pity is that the pink girl who keeps yawning on the side breaks this beautiful atmosphere.
Tali, who was left alone in the Windslet tribe to take care of Lena, has been extremely bored these days, and after the initial novelty has passed, she has been so listless. With her lively and active temperament, now she can only be "trapped" in place and can't go far, which makes her even more uncomfortable than killing her.
Luckily, Kashair isn't usually busy, and Tali will go to her to chat when she's bored to pass the time.
However, since the beginning of the tribe, Tali has clearly sensed that Kasha Yir has a lot more on her mind.
At first, Tali couldn't bear to ask, but for several days Kashayl was preoccupied, and even when she talked to her, she would get distracted, and Tali, who couldn't hide her thoughts, finally asked.
Probably trying to find someone to talk to, Tali asked, and Kaisa Ille didn't hide the slightest hint of her troubles.
At first, Tali thought she was worried about the safety of Kumar in the desert, and was about to say that it was impossible for the two masters of Liqi and Saya to accompany him, but it didn't come to pass, although Kashayir was also a little worried about his son who participated in the big competition, but what really worried him was the daughter who was in the Windlord tribe at the moment.
The news that Kumar has a sister, Leach didn't tell anyone, after all, Leach agreed to Kumar to participate in his sister's martial arts competition, although he had a clear conscience, but Leach always felt that in this matter, he couldn't raise his head in the face of Saya and Tali, so it was naturally impossible to spread it around.
Tali also didn't know until now that Kaishayl had a daughter, and her curiosity was immediately seduced, and she immediately pestered her to ask this and that.
Through Kashail's story, Tali learns that Kumar's sister is the daughter of a god of great honor in the savannah, and she also understands why she has lived here for so long and has never seen Kashail's daughter.
To Kasha'il's dismay, on the third day after the departure of the warriors who participated in the Tabi, Muhandil suddenly proposed to carry out the ceremony of choosing a husband for the daughter of the god in advance, on the grounds that those warriors who participated in the selection were running for the position of the lord of the grass, and the husband of the daughter of the god must put the daughter of the god first.
Muhantil's reasoning sounded very reasonable at first glance, but Nirk was not easy to fool, although he did not know what Muhantil's idea was, but it was not a good thing for the Windlord tribe, so he immediately retorted that the husband of the daughter of God must be a good man who stood up to the heavens and the earth, and those who did not even dare to participate in the trial were not worthy of the daughter of God at all.
Although the strength of the frostwolf tribe has increased by leaps and bounds in recent years, not all tribes have fallen to their side, some agree with Muhantil's proposal, and some firmly support Nirk, and the two sides quarrel over this matter.
As a mother, Kashair doesn't care about the dignity of the daughter of the gods, what she hopes most is that her daughter can be happy. The hatred between the wind owl and the frost wolf, Kasha'il knew better than anyone else, and naturally did not want Muhantil's proposal to be adopted.
It's just that she doesn't look at her as the biological mother of the daughter of God, but she is a soft-spoken person in this matter, and she doesn't have the slightest say at all. According to the rules of the prairie, the daughter of the god is the daughter of the god of the steppe, and Kashayir is just a medium, and she is not qualified to care about this and that at all.
What bothered Casa was that she was afraid that Nilk would not be able to withstand the pressure and finally make a compromise.
After hearing this, Tali immediately angrily said that she would help. In the final analysis, she has begun to have some fantasies about beautiful love at this age, although it is not yet the extent of the beginning of love, but the most unaccustomed thing is that someone is blocking it for some ulterior purpose.
Ignoring Kashail's resistance, Tali walked angrily towards the tent where all the tribal leaders had gathered. As she walked, Tali couldn't help but think of the heroes in the novel who went to the meeting alone, and an inexplicable sense of pride arose, and even her steps were much lighter.
Closer, Tali could already hear the argument coming from the tent, and casually tossed the guard at the door aside, and she lifted the curtain and broke in.
Inside the tent, Nikl and Muhantil sat at the head on the left and right, and the leaders of the other tribes sat in two rows below.
When Tali broke in, the two factions were arguing with red faces and thick necks, and they looked like they would start to do without saying a word, and no one noticed that there was suddenly a little girl in the tent.
"Shut it all up!" Seeing that she was being ignored, Tali took a deep breath and shouted at the top of her throat.
There was an eerie silence in the noisy tent, and then it became more noisy.
Only this time it wasn't a quarrel with each other, but all the leaders pointed the finger at Tali.
"Where did you come from, little girl, this is not the place where you should come, where to go back and forth!"
"That's it, hurry up and go home to find your mother to feed!"
"I don't know how thick the sky is, how can you have a little girl who hasn't been weaned here?"
"Don't hurry up and leave, don't go again and wait for the board!"
"Come on, throw this little girl out of here!"
"What a thousand people are referring to", but Tali did not have the slightest fear, crossed her waist and scolded: "You have not been weaned, your whole family has not been weaned! A group of decrepit ghosts, perverts, and dead old men have gathered together to discuss how to harm a girl, it is really shameful!"
Tali's words completely angered everyone, and some of the grumpy ones stood up suddenly, ready to teach this wild girl who popped up out of nowhere.
At the top, Muhantil, who was also scolded, was not annoyed at all, and whispered to Nirk sideways: "Team Leader Nikk, who is this girl, why have I never seen it, which one is she singing?"
Nilk touched his nose in embarrassment, the dead old man of Tali just now scolded him too, and he was the oldest of you here, and when he heard this, he said: "This is a guest of our Windlord tribe, a companion of Leach, as for what she wants to do, I don't know very well." ”
The two of them were whispering here, and over there, Tali was about to fight a strong man.
In any case, Tali is a guest of the Windlord tribe, so Nickel naturally can't afford to ignore it, coughing lightly and shouting "stop". To his surprise, he was joined by Muhandir.
The leaders of the two largest tribes in the steppe spoke at the same time, and it was impossible for the others not to give face, and the scene was quiet again.
